PORTLAND, Ore. – After earning GNAC Baseball Player of the Week honors earlier in the week, Northwest Nazarene’s Colby Moran has become the second consecutive player in the conference to be named the NCBWA Division II West Region Player of the Week.

The sophomore from Murrieta, California was a top contributor at the plate for the Nighthawks last week against Western Oregon as they surged past the Wolves and back to the top of the GNAC standings. Moran finished the week with a .571 batting average after going 8 for 14 with four runs, two doubles, a triple, two home runs and five RBIs against the top pitching staff in the conference.

Moran earns the regional honor one week after Central Washington’s Austin Ohland received the same recognition. It is the third time a GNAC player has received west region weekly honors this season with Saint Martin’s Justice Yamashita being named Pitcher of the Week earlier in the year.

After opening the series against Western Oregon slowly on Friday, Moran would not be denied for the remainder of the weekend. He bounced back in game two, going 2 for 3 with a double and a home run to go with an RBI and a run. He notched his first home run of the week in the second inning, launching a solo shot over the left-field fence to help NNU to an 11-7 victory.

Moran got even hotter on Saturday, opening the day with a 3 for 4 effort in Northwest Nazarene’s narrow 6-5 win. He finished the game with four RBIs and two runs scored courtesy of a home run and a double. After trailing in the top of the first inning, Moran gave NNU the lead in the bottom of the first with a two RBI double. He followed that up with his second homer of the week, a two-run blast, in the fifth inning to score the eventual game-winning run.

Moran closed out the series by going 3 for 3 with a triple and a run scored in the Nighthawks’ 9-1 victory. He finished the four-game set with a .571 on base percentage and a 1.286 slugging percentage.

The regional weekly honor is the first of Moran’s career. Selected by the National Collegiate Baseball Writers Association, the West Region honoree recognizes the top player from the GANC, CCAA and PacWest conferences.

Along with Cal State San Bernardino’s Dylan O’Connor, the West Region Pitcher of the Week, and seven other regional player and pitcher honorees, Moran is now eligible to be selected by the NCBWA as the Division II National Player of the Week.
